You are not wrong. The stock class is just that BOX stock. No bearings or any modifications to the car/chassie. Any rubber tirescan be used (no foams) and only Kyosho wheels (plastic no alloy). The "open" is just Koysho upgrades with the exception of Batteries and bearings. Any bearings and any batterie can be used. Oh yea, The stock is just alkaline Batteries.
